Summary

Lincoln Elementary School is a K-5 public school serving about 300 students in the Olympia School District, notable for its impressive academic turnaround over the last decade.

The school has shown remarkable improvement, rising from a lower-performing to a solidly above-average school, now consistently earning 3-4 star ratings. Its current test scores in English, Math, and Science are all above the state average, with science being a particular strength. Lincoln stands out for its exceptional support for special education students, where it ranks in the top quarter of schools statewide. Interestingly, the school achieves these strong results while serving a more economically diverse population and operating with a higher student-to-teacher ratio than some neighboring schools like Garfield Elementary School or Roosevelt Elementary School.

When compared to other schools, Lincoln performs better than others with similar student demographics, such as Leland P Brown Elementary, while trailing higher-performing schools like Centennial Elementary and Pioneer Elementary. A notable area for attention is a significant performance gap between male and female students. Overall, Lincoln's story is one of effective growth, demonstrating strong outcomes for its student community and exceptional success in specific areas like special education.

Open Quote Lincoln is an Options program that involves the family and community. It shares a holistic approach to teaching, incorporating care of self, others, community and earth. It has a wonderful organic garden and green house that is cared for by the students, teachers and volunteers. Science, Spanish, music, handwork, arts and food are included in the curriculum. The teachers are caring and creative, very valuable people. If this is a fit for your family, it is a wonderful place to learn. Close Quote
